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Ford Kuga has a decisively advantage in terms of price – it starts at 34200 £, while the VW Touareg costs 64300 £. That’s a price difference of around 30065 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: Ford Kuga manages with 2.80 L and is therefore significantly more efficient than the VW Touareg with 5.20 L. The difference is about 2.40 L per 100 km.

As for range, the Ford Kuga performs noticeable better – achieving up to 68 km, about 19 km more than the VW Touareg.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the VW Touareg has a significantly edge – offering 462 HP compared to 243 HP. That’s roughly 219 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the VW Touareg is decisively quicker – completing the sprint in 5.10 s, while the Ford Kuga takes 7.30 s. That’s about 2.20 s faster.

In terms of top speed, the VW Touareg performs somewhat better – reaching 250 km/h, while the Ford Kuga tops out at 200 km/h. The difference is around 50 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: VW Touareg pulls decisively stronger with 700 Nm compared to 240 Nm. That’s about 460 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In curb weight, Ford Kuga is clearly perceptible lighter – 1526 kg compared to 2059 kg. The difference is around 533 kg.

In terms of boot space, the VW Touareg offers clearly more room – 810 L compared to 412 L. That’s a difference of about 398 L.

In maximum load capacity, the VW Touareg performs slightly better – up to 1800 L, which is about 266 L more than the Ford Kuga.

When it comes to payload, VW Touareg evident takes the win – 751 kg compared to 550 kg. That’s a difference of about 201 kg.

The Kuga is Ford’s adaptable family SUV that blends usable space with a surprisingly lively driving character, making daily commutes and weekend escapes equally enjoyable. With smart interior packaging, an easy-to-use infotainment setup and composed road manners, it’s a sensible choice for buyers who want a bit of fun without the fuss.

Volkswagen Touareg wraps a grown-up presence in a classy, well-appointed cabin that feels more like a premium saloon than an SUV. It glides with quiet composure, devours long journeys and tucks away clever tech that makes life easier whether you’re stuck in town or nipping off the beaten track.
